Worried of HIV

I never had sex before and 3 weeks ago I had it with a female sex worker. The oral went for 2 min and I had condom (Trojan Spermicidal one) during the oral as well as Vaginal.

I am not sure after taking off the condom I cleaned my hand soon or not. or I might have touched my penis and after 3 weeks I came to know tht I am infected with HPV virus which causes the genital warts. I am now worried about HIV. Avatar universal
At no time did you have a risk of contracting HIV in the situations that you have provided. Keep using the condoms correctly and consistently and you'll stay HIV negative.
